Job Description
Have you ever played a game and been frustrated by poor or incomplete translation, supposed jokes, cultural references that were out of place? Well this is your chance to a made real difference in making games more suitable for their target audiences. We want you to bring your passion for both games and language. Localisation testing involves performing language checks on a range of games for a variety of platforms including PC, Xbox 360, PS3, Wii, PSP, DS and various mobile phones.
Main Duties
- Identifying spelling, grammar, punctuation and other language errors
- Identifying cultural issues
- Logging details of errors/issues found and providing suggestions for improvements
- Ad hoc translation
Person Specification
- Native level fluency in Turkish
- Strong English language skills
- Strong cultural understanding of English and the language you are applying for
- Strong personal gaming experience
- Great team worker
- Excellent attention to detail
- Ability to communicate clearly and concisely
- Previous experience, particularly in console submission processes will be a distinct advantage but isn’t essential
